Output 8e887546344e7cc1daeb7a74e052d172d19f54b3d8600cdabcb0500847ce0060:1

value
259857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d0fbc57cfc0dbdc0c897c0dd88b77931a0fb5d OP_EQUAL
address
3FMAxZ3rPQeFZVy3HmN15CowyFcG5Ndksp
transaction
8e887546344e7cc1daeb7a74e052d172d19f54b3d8600cdabcb0500847ce0060
confirmations
387983
spent
true